It began with centuries of sakoku, a policy of national seclusion that preserved Japan’s cultural integrity but also limited external engagement. Then, in 1868, the Meiji Restoration marked a turning point: the imperial court reclaimed political authority, launched sweeping reforms, and abruptly opened Japan to the global stage—within a timeline that—even by modern standards—feels astonishingly fast.

How did this isolation end so precisely? The answer lies in a strategic, top-down modernization effort. The new government sent delegations abroad, studied Western technologies and governance models, and swiftly industrialized infrastructure, education, and military systems. At the same time, traditional social hierarchies were restructured to support rapid adaptation. This blend of disciplined innovation and cautious reform allowed Japan not only to avoid colonization but to emerge as a regional power by the early 20th century.
